Harvard Dames Announce Program

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The Society of Harvard Dames is planning an ambitious program for its next two biweekly meetings. On Thursday, March 10, Professor A. N. Holcombe '06 will lecture on "National Polities." Mrs. A. L. Lowell will be the guest of honor. Two weeks later President Eliot will speak on "The Influence of Women on the Manners and Customs of Men."
